I used Very Vanilla as my neutral over Basic White because I like the extra warmth it gives. The card front is embossed using the Joined Together embossing folder and the centre panels are cut using the Branching Out dies.

On the smaller Very Vanilla panel I stamped one of the wreath stamps from Joyful Tidings using Shaded Spruce ink.


After layering that onto the Gold Foil panel, I added in the die cut greeting. I used the Words for the Season dies - which I have to confess that I'd actually forgotten I'd bought. I found them when I was cleaning out a basket of things I'd used for an online presentation in October!

Then I finished off with a trio of Traditional Sparkling Sequins in red.
